How accessible are these historical figure-related landmarks for tourists visiting Palma?

The historical figure-related landmarks in Palma are generally quite accessible to tourists, ensuring that visitors can easily explore and appreciate the city’s rich heritage. Palma’s well-developed infrastructure includes clear signage, convenient public transportation, and pedestrian-friendly streets, which facilitate access to key sites linked to historical personalities. For instance, landmarks associated with King James I, who played a significant role in Palma’s history, are located within or near the city center, making them reachable by foot or short public transport journeys. Additionally, many landmarks offer multilingual information panels and guided tours, enhancing the visitor experience by providing context and background to the historical figures commemorated there.

Most attractions dedicated to historical figures in Palma also cater to varying levels of physical ability. Many sites have ramps and elevators where needed, ensuring that tourists with mobility challenges can visit comfortably. Some older buildings or structures may present minor accessibility limitations due to their preserved historical architecture, but efforts have been made to improve access wherever possible. Entrance fees to these landmarks tend to be reasonable, and combined tickets or tourist passes often include them, making it convenient for travelers to visit multiple sites affordably.

Moreover, the cultural institutions and museums related to Palma’s history maintain regular opening hours, with peak visiting seasons offering extended times to accommodate increased tourist traffic. Visitors can also find ample amenities such as nearby cafes and rest areas, allowing for a comfortable and enjoyable exploration. Overall, those interested in the historical figures of Palma will find the city’s landmarks both approachable and well-supported by visitor facilities, making it an engaging destination for history enthusiasts.
